I haven't really put much thought into this yet, but I 'd like to know people's thoughts on this. I doubt we'll sign the guy, but if we did, where would he play, As the article points out, there are basically two options:
A.) He plays 3B, moving Braun to the OF, or
B.) We play him at 2B and move Weeks to CF
The thought of Iguchi on out team is intriguing, but I feel like there are better options out there. I'd rather see the money spent on good bullpen help or a true LFer. (How about a home town discount, Geoff Jenkins?) Maybe he's part of the package that will bring Carl Crawford to town.
